Description

The USDA Forest Service is considering a contract that consists of improving effective drainage on Dodge Summit and Poverty Creek roads, USFS Road(s) 470 and 7211. This contract would require furnishing labor, equipment (fully operated), supervision, transportation, operating supplies and incidentals to complete this project in accordance with any Plans, Drawings, Specifications, or Special Project Provisions.



The contractor shall be required to have a mapping program, like Avenza Maps, on their smart phone, tablet or GPS device that can read the pdf maps provided in the contract in order to display and locate the contract items.




  • Project Location – RD 470 and 7211, T38N R28W, Lincoln County, MT

  • Estimated Start Date - It is anticipated that work can begin in Spring, 2023.

  • Government-Furnished Property (GFP) – None

  • Permits - The contractor is responsible for all necessary permits including One Call 1-800-795-0555 before you dig.



Scope may include removal and disposal of culverts; drainage excavation, type catch basin and compaction; light roadside reconditioning and compaction; corrugated steel pipe culverts and compaction; installation of drop inlet and compaction; removal of SWD and applicable disposal; and installation of open top concrete culverts.
